 | | I never even thought of this stamp this morning when I looked at the sketch. But when I came up after work to try to decide what to use, look what stamped image was sitting on my desk. Ready coloured and all, been sitting there for a few days because I wasn't totally happy with it. So no hesitations at all about tearing a bit off the right-hand edge to make it fit the sketch.
A2 kraft base. SU paper from Welcome Neighbour, edges torn and sponged. I can't remember, but I think I coloured the image with re-inkers, and masked the bird and flowers to sponge the rest. Added Liquid Pearls to the centres of the flowers.
Layered up a paper Prima with some fabric flowers and attached with a gem brad. Bonjour from Carte Postale was stamped on the same DP, punched with the small oval punch, edges sponged and then popped up on foam. |
